The Primary Schools Festival of Music is an iconic South Australian tradition that has inspired generations. It gives students the chance to experience artistic excellence, embrace cultural diversity, and celebrate social inclusion through the joy of performance.
Each concert featured 1,300 Year 5 and 6 students joining voices in a breathtaking massed choir. Audiences were also treated to Guest Artists from primary and secondary schools, vibrant performances across a range of musical genres, and impressive showcases from the orchestra and troupe.
This year’s concert opened with Robbie Williams’ electrifying Let Me Entertain You and closed on a powerful high with John Farnham’s iconic You’re the Voice, complete with stirring bagpipes that lifted the arena.
